    Benjamin Alan Joyce (born September 17, 2000) is an American professional baseball pitcher for the Los Angeles Angels of Major League Baseball (MLB). He played college baseball at the University of Tennessee, where he gained acclaim for throwing the fastest pitch in college baseball history at 105.5 miles per hour (169.8 km/h).

    This is a list of the top 100 Major League Baseball pitchers who have the most hit batsmen of all time. Gus Weyhing (277) [1] [2] holds the dubious record for most hit batsmen in a career. Chick Fraser (219), [3] Pink Hawley (210), [4] and Walter Johnson (205) [5] are the only other pitchers to hit 200 or more batters in their careers.
